The TFTuesday Podcast is a podcast for all your TF-ey needs! Featuring in-depth discussions amongst longtime TF artists. The TFTuesday podcast focuses on transformation, mainly in the niche of the furry community. Content warning: This podcast occasionally touches on NSFW topics. Frequently Asked Questions About TFTuesday Podcast

What is TFTuesday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Exploring the vibrant intersection of transformation fiction (TF) and the furry community, this podcast features engaging dialogues that span a variety of topics, including personal artistic journeys, community dynamics, and the significance of identity within transformation narratives. The hosts invite guests ranging from transformational artists to writers, all contributing to discussions that reflect the complexities and humorous aspects of the transformation genre. Unique episodes also incorporate live interactions and community events, which enrich the content by allowing audience participation and fostering a sense of belonging among listeners.
